PERSONAL NOTES
Mrs. C. Mackie Begg, Dunedin, is visiting Wellington on business of the Women's War Service Auxiliary. She will remain in Wellington in order to meet her son, Dr. A. C. Begg, on his return from overseas.
Miss Pat Kidd, Auckland, arrived at Wellington yesterday to stay with Mrs. C. M. Brooker. She will visit Mrs. Eardley Fenwick, Lower Hutt, before returning home.
Mrs. W. Fullerton-Smith is a Marton visitor to Otaki Beach.
Miss Elizabeth Collins, Wairarapa, is staying at Darfield, Canterbury, as the guest of Miss Jane Deans.
Mrs. W. H. Gledhill and Miss Marie Gledhill, Khandallah, will leave on Sunday for ten days' holiday in Auckland.
Miss Bobby Gibbons, Lyall Bay, returned on Wednesday from a holiday in the South Island.
Mrs. H. Jackson, Auckland, who has been staying with her daughter, Mrs. R. D. Young, Lower Hutt, has. returned north.
